We had a very good experience at Hotel Flora, but you need to make sure to request a large room. The location is great, the garden very nice, and the owners were very friendly and helpful to us.

My experience at the Flora a few years ago was also very positive. My single room was very small,but for just me it was fine. Outstanding location, all services, pretty courtyard, elevator, continental breakfast.

My husband and I, and our adult daughter, stayed at the Ala three years ago and loved it. To save money we picked one of the cheaper rooms, but it overlooked a side canal and we had gondolas passing outside our window. The location couldn't be better, and the staff was very helpful (making dinner reservations for us, for example). There's an outdoor cafe next door where my husband liked to enjoy a pre-dinner drink.

We stayed at hotel Ala in 2002 and loved it. The location is great and there are tons of dining options nearby. We had one of their larger rooms that overlooking the side canal.
Their breakfast was OK.

We stayed at the Flora once and will never return. We like the quaintness of 2 and 3 star hotels, but the room we had in the Flora was a dump and tiny. I have never had a problem with the reception clerks except at the Flora.
